About EPS (Diluted) at CBRE Group (CBRE)

According to CBRE Group's latest reported financial statements, the company's current diluted EPS (TTM) is $4.38. Diluted earnings per share (EPS) is net income divided by the diluted weighted-average shares outstanding over the period. It expresses profit on a per-share basis — the figure investors use to value an individual share — and accounts for potential dilution from options, RSUs, and convertible securities.

Headline TTM above sums the four reported quarters through (reported ). Chart and table below cover the full reported history back to .

CBRE Group (CBRE) most recent annual diluted EPS stands at $3.85 (2025) – grew 22.6% year-over-year.

Looking at the 2020–2025 (5 years) stretch, CBRE Group diluted EPS compounded at +11.6% per year, with mixed annual results across the window.

Between 2021 and 2025, CBRE Group diluted EPS declined 28.8%, falling from $5.41 to $3.85.

Across the available history, diluted EPS reached its high of $5.41 in 2021 and its low of −$4.81 in 2008.
